Cabin Steward / Stewardess

The Cabin Steward or Stewardess is responsible for the daily cleaning, tidiness, and hygienic maintenance of assigned passenger cabins. Their duties involve making beds, replacing towels, replenishing amenities, and ensuring the cabin is presented perfectly twice a day. They often build a direct rapport with guests, handling specific requests and ensuring the highest level of comfort and personalized service within the guest's private living space.
